Description: The purpose of the present study is (1.) to conceptually replicate the findings by Stevenson and colleagues (2012) and Schaller and colleagues (2010), (2.) to modify their methods by using videos and photos as stimuli, and (3.) to further investigate whether the S-IgA immune response differs for different kinds of disgust. For this purpose, our study measures (1.) the changes in S-IgA secretion in saliva and self-reported state-disgust in response to the different video-primes, (2.) approach-avoidance tendencies to faces in varying states of health (the Visual Approach/Avoidance by the Self Task; VAAST; Rougier et al., 2018), (3.) the perceived vulnerability to disease (VTD questionnaire based on Duncan et al. 2009), and (4.) self-reported trait-disgust (Disgust-Scale [DS-R], based on Olatunji et al., 2007).
